      <description>&lt;p&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Bananagrams will make you laugh until you cry&lt;/strong&gt;&lt;br/&gt;I first spied the yellow zippered banana-shaped bag in a gift shop in Durango, Colorado.....the minute my sister and I realized it held letter tiles for a crossword speed game, we bought it and took it home anxious to play.&#160; Our dad is a crossword junkie, and we are both Scrabble addicts.&#160;&#160; Turned out to&#160;be the best&#160;$15&#160;we ever spent!&#160; &#160; &l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;&lt;strong&gt;The first time we played this game, we were hooked&lt;/strong&gt;&lt;br/&gt;You dump all the letters upside on the table, then take 18 letters each (for 3 players).&#160;&#160; Everyone turns over their letters at the same time, then starts making their own crossword puzzle using every letter.&#160; Just like Scrabble, no capitalized words, no contractions, no acronyms, no foreign language.&#160;&l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;&lt;strong&gt;How it Works&lt;/strong&gt;&lt;br/&gt;As soon as the first person has&#160;used all&#160;his tiles, he shouts PEEL, at which point he and all&#160;the other players must take a tile.&#160;&#160; This new tile is often placed quickly by the person who&#160;&quot;peeled,&quot; meaning he will likely keep shouting&#160;&quot;Peel!&quot;...&lt;/p&gt;... </description>

      <description>I took my kids this past weekend to the Redmoon Theater to see their Winter Pageant. Honestly, I dont even know how to describe this 50 minute show other than magical- simply magical.&l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;The Winter Pageant at the Redmoon is a visual wonder- celebrating the 4 seasons of Chicago with limited language and extravagant sets and visuals. There is use of lights, bubbles, darkness, movement, and more. Think a hybrid of blue man group and circ de solei and a broadway set. &l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;I didnt know how my kids would react to the play but they were soooo taken by the show. The actors and actresses start 15 minutes early and engage the kids from moment one. The 50 minute show continues to engage them every step of the way. And, at the end, they even bring out cookies and parts of the set to look at closely.&l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;If you can fit in a visit to the Redmoon Theater before the 21st of December, I would strongly encourage you to go. The Winter Pagent is amazing for both kids and adults and for only $10-$15 per ticket- it is a must...... </description>
